Kappa angles in different positions in patients with myopia during LASIK

Abstract

AIM: To investigate the difference in kappa angle between sitting and supine positions during laser-assisted in situ keratomileusis (LASIK). METHODS: A retrospective study was performed on 395 eyes from 215 patients with myopia that received LASIK. Low, moderate, and high myopia groups were assigned according to diopters. The horizontal and vertical components of kappa angle in sitting position were measured before the operation, and in supine position during the operation. The data from the two positions were compared and the relationship between kappa angle and diopters were analyzed. RESULTS: Two hundred and twenty-three eyes (56.5%) in sitting position and 343 eyes (86.8%) in supine position had positive kappa angles. There were no significant differences in horizontal and vertical components of kappa angle in the sitting position or horizontal components of kappa angle in the supine position between the three groups (P>0.05). A significant difference in the vertical components of kappa angle in the supine position was seen in the three groups (P<0.01). Differences in both horizontal and vertical components of kappa angles were significant between the sitting and supine positions. Positive correlations in both horizontal and vertical components of kappa angles (P<0.05) were found and vertical components of kappa angle in sitting and supine positions were negatively correlated with the degree of myopia (sitting position: r=-0.109; supine position: r=-0.172; P<0.05). CONCLUSION: There is a correlation in horizontal and vertical components of kappa angle in sitting and supine positions. Positive correlations in both horizontal and vertical components of kappa angle in sitting and supine positions till the end of the results. This result still needs further observation. Clinicians should take into account different postures when excimer laser surgery needs to be performed.
